Default Automatic To Manuel Sway

Aight everyone. I ran into a little problem. I'm attempting to swap out my girls auto trans and put in a manuel trans but I'm not sure if I have everything I need yet. I'm also wondering whether or not I'm in over my head. The following things are what I have already:

Trans from a D15 block
Clutch
Brake, Gas, and Clutch Pedals
Short Shifter
Hydraulic Lines
New Master Cylinder
Slave Cylinder
And Mounts That Came Off The D15 Trans

Is there anything that I am missing besides the ecu and idle air control?
And I know if I elect not to but the ecu in then I will get a Check Engine Light and also, something with it won't have a normal rev limiter. What will the rev limiter be until I replace this? If anyone can help me I would appreciate it! Any advise will help at this time. I'm almost ready to sell everything and keep her car a automatic!

Default Re: Automatic To Manuel Sway

eg?

if so you need to drill out the tack welds that hold the trans mount on to the unibody and reweld a 5speed mount.

when taking the auto shifter out rewire the car so it thinks it's in park/neutral so it will start. should start and drive fine the ecu won't know the difference

shift linkage?
flywheel?
rear torq mount?
